Responsibilities

  • Conduct advanced threat hunting and 24/7 incident response for critical security breaches.
  • Design, implement, and manage robust network security architectures and firewalls.
  • Perform comprehensive vulnerability assessments and penetration testing on systems and applications.
  • Monitor security alerts and analytics dashboards to identify anomalies and potential threats in real-time.
  • Develop and maintain security policies, procedures, and compliance documentation (GDPR, HIPAA, NIST).
  • Lead security awareness training programs for employees and conduct regular security audits.

Qualifications

  •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P) or GIAC (GPEN, GCFA) certification is required.
  • Minimum of 5-7 years of experience in cybersecurity, with at least 2 years in a senior or lead role.
  • Deep understanding of TCP/IP, VPNs, IDS/IPS, and firewall configurations.
  • Proficiency with SIEM tools (e.g., Splunk, Sentinel) and scripting languages (Python, Bash).
  • Strong knowledge of cloud security principles (AWS, Azure, or GCP).
  •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to communicate complex security conc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
